According to the public record, 20, Denmark Road, Exeter is a early-century freehold house with 1,463 ft2 of internal area.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 4 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 20, Denmark Road, Exeter is £531,984 and the estimated rental value is £1,633 per month.
Denmark Road, Exeter, EX1 is located in the borough of Exeter within the EX1 postal district.
20, Denmark Road, Exeter has a single entry in the Land Registry from November 2017 and a single entry in the EPC database dated July 2017.
We combine this information with that of neighbouring properties to estimate the property attributes and values.
The local information is scored as 3 out of 5 and is considered of medium accuracy.
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 20, Denmark Road, Exeter is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£558,584 and a rental value of £1,715 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£494,746 and a rental value of £1,519 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of 20 Denmark Road Exeter has increased by an estimated £6,657 (1.3%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£55 per month (3.4%), giving an expected gross yield of 3.7%.
20, Denmark Road, Exeter has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of E.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 06 Jul 2017.
The property is connected to mains gas and has mostly double glazing.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
According to HM Land Registry, 20, Denmark Road, Exeter was last sold on 3rd November 2017 for £410,000 and was recorded as a freehold house.
The property has only had this single sale since 1995.
